RedPulse insight

How to think about r/twitch_startup

This community is dedicated to supporting new and undervalued streamers on Twitch, providing a space for networking, sharing tips, and improving streaming skills. Members can post their channels, seek feedback, and discover other streamers to watch. The focus on collaboration and mutual growth distinguishes it from other Twitch-related communities, fostering a supportive environment for those looking to enhance their presence on the platform.

  • Audience

    Participants are primarily aspiring and small-scale Twitch streamers, often ranging from teens to young adults. They are typically motivated by a desire to grow their channels and connect with like-minded individuals. The vibe is generally supportive and collaborative, with members eager to share advice and resources to help each other succeed in the competitive streaming landscape.

  • Posting culture

    Content that thrives includes constructive feedback requests, success stories, and tips for improving streams. Members are encouraged to engage with one another positively, while self-promotion should be done thoughtfully to avoid being downvoted. Regular participation and sharing of experiences are valued, with a cadence that supports ongoing discussions about streaming techniques and community events.

  • Brand engagement notes

    Brands looking to engage with this community should focus on providing value rather than overt promotion. Sharing educational content, hosting Q&A sessions, or offering tools that help streamers improve their craft can resonate well. However, direct advertising or promotional posts are likely to be met with skepticism or hostility. Authenticity and a genuine interest in the community's growth are essential for successful engagement.
